The LEDE Project (Linux Embedded Development Environment) is a Linux operating system based on OpenWrt. It is a complete replacement for the vendor-supplied firmware of a wide range of wireless routers and non-network devices.
In this instructor-led, live training, participants will learn how to set up a LEDE based wireless router.

Shadowsocks is an open-source, secure socks5 proxy.
In this instructor-led, live training, participants will learn how to secure an internet connection through a Shadowsocks proxy.
By the end of this training, participants will be able to:
Install and configure Shadowsocks on any of a number of supported platforms, including Windows, Linux, Mac, Android, iOS, and OpenWrt.
Deploy Shadosocks with package manager systems, such as pip, aur, freshports and others.
Run Shadowsocks on mobile devices and wireless networks.
Understand how Shadowsocks encrypts messages and ensures integrity and authenticity.
Optimize a Shadowsocks server
